Plumbing Camera Service in Anne Arundel County, MD
Plumbing camera services involve the use of specialized video equipment to inspect the interior of pipes and drains. This technology allows property owners to identify issues such as blockages, leaks, corrosion, or pipe damage without invasive digging or dismantling. These inspections are useful for a variety of projects, including locating the source of persistent clogs, assessing the condition of aging pipes, or checking for tree root intrusion. Homeowners typically request this service when experiencing slow drains, foul odors, or recurring plumbing problems that require a clear understanding of what is happening inside the plumbing system.
Before requesting plumbing camera services, property owners should consider the scope of the inspection needed and whether specific problem areas have been identified. It’s helpful to have an idea of the location of suspected issues, such as under a specific fixture or along certain sections of piping. Clear access points or cleanouts can facilitate the inspection process. Understanding the general layout of the plumbing system and any prior repairs or issues can also assist in diagnosing problems more effectively. This service provides valuable insights that can guide repairs, maintenance, or replacements, ensuring that the plumbing system functions efficiently and reliably.

Common Plumbing Camera Service Jobs
Drain inspections - identify blockages and pipe damage behind walls or underground.
Sewer line assessments - detect leaks, cracks, or tree root intrusion in main sewer lines.
Pipe condition evaluations - locate corrosion, collapses, or obstructions inside plumbing pipes.
Clog detection - pinpoint hard-to-reach clogs in kitchen, bathroom, or laundry drains.
Leak investigations - find hidden leaks that may cause water damage or mold growth.
Pre-purchase plumbing surveys - assess the condition of plumbing systems before buying a property.
Plumbing Camera Service Questions
What is plumbing camera service used for? It is used to inspect pipes for blockages, leaks, and damage without invasive digging.
How does a plumbing camera help locate issues? The camera provides visual access inside pipes, making it easier to identify the exact problem area.
Can plumbing camera services detect tree root intrusion? Yes, the camera can reveal tree roots that have penetrated pipes and caused blockages or damage.
Is plumbing camera inspection suitable for drain cleaning? It helps identify the cause of clogs and guides effective cleaning methods for drains and sewer lines.
